Copa Argentina, also known as Copa Total Argentina, is a professional football cup in Argentina for men. There are overall 87 teams that compete for the title every year between January and December. The current holder of the title is Patronato and the team that holds the most titles is Boca Juniors. Competition format of Copa Argentina
The first edition of the Copa Argentina took place in 2011 when the first cup winner was Boca Juniors. The teams compete in a knockout system over 8 rounds and the game winners qualify to the next stage.
Top scorers and goals
The top scorers in the Copa Argentina 2022 season were Jesús Dátolo, Marcelo Estigarribia with 4 goals. The average number of goals in the cup for season 2023 is 2.78 per game.
TV partners and official organization
The largest TV partner for Copa Argentina is TyC Sports. The organization that is in charge of the cup is Argentine Football Association.
